Joseph L. Sidor, Sr., 79, formerly of Easton and Walnutport, passed away Sunday, March 9, 2025, at Lehigh Valley Hospital, Cedar Crest. He was the beloved husband of Carol J. (Knappenberger) Sidor, whom he married August 28, 1971. Born in Northampton on September 10, 1945, he was the son of the late Joseph E. and Hilda (Seiler) Sidor. Joseph served his country honorably and proudly as a member of the US Air Force from 1965 – 1969. Joe retired from Geo Specialty in Allentown. Prior to that, he worked briefly for Deka and also worked many years for the former Caloric Company of Topton.
In addition to his wife Carol, he will be lovingly remembered by his son: Joseph L. Sidor, Jr., and wife Theresa of Glendon, PA; grandson: Patrik Sidor; sister: Cassandra Handwerk of Lehighton; brothers: Thomas Sidor and wife Linda of Northampton; Timothy Sidor of Allentown. He was predeceased by a son, Mark Sidor in 2010.
A funeral service will be held at 7pm on Friday, March 14, 2025, at Harding Funeral Home, 25-27 N. 2nd St, Slatington. Family and friends may pay their respects from 5:30 to 7:00PM. Interment will be private. In lieu of flowers, contributions can be made to the Parkison’s Foundation, 1359 Broadway, Ste 1509, New York, NY 10018.
